Motorsport is back, and doesn’t it feel good? We’ve already had the Rolex 24 at Daytona and the Monte Carlo Rally, but this weekend it’s time for another corker as we head down under to Australia for the 2020 Bathurst 12 Hour.
It is, without a doubt, one of the most exciting races of the year. With GT3 and GT4 cars wrestling for space on the 6.2km track, and a special invitational class for “cars deemed eligible by the organisers” that don’t quite fit into the GT3 and GT4 classes, there is always, always drama. What’s more, the scenery, altitude (the Mount Panorama circuit sits 862m above sea level), weather and time of day all combine to produce some gorgeous imagery. Many race tracks are not beautiful, but Mount Panorama certainly is.
As regular Goodwood columnist Andrew Frankel said after his visit to the 2019 Bathurst 12 Hour: “If you only ever go to one motor race outside the UK, don’t go to Le Mans. Don’t go to the Monaco Grand Prix, and don’t go to the Indy 500. Instead get on a plane for a flight that will seem at times like it will never end, then once you’ve arrived in Sydney Australia, rent a car and drive three hours west to Bathurst.”
